How to fill out patient claim form

How to fill out a patient claim form:
01
Start by gathering all necessary documents and information. This may include your personal identification details, insurance information, medical bills, and any supporting documentation related to your claim.
02
Carefully read through the instructions provided on the form. These instructions will guide you on how to properly fill out each section of the form.
03
Begin by filling out the patient's personal information section. This typically includes their full name, date of birth, address, and contact details.
04
Move on to providing the insurance information. This will involve inputting the name of the insurance company, policy number, group number, and any other required details.
05
Next, fill in the details of the healthcare provider or facility where the services were rendered. Include the name, address, and contact information.
06
Provide a detailed description of the services or treatments received. Include the date of each service, the diagnosis or reason for the visit, and any relevant prescription details.
07
If applicable, include any supporting documentation such as copies of medical records, invoices, or receipts. These can help strengthen your claim and provide evidence of the services rendered.
08
Double-check all the information you have provided to ensure accuracy. Any errors or missing information can result in delays or denials of your claim.
09
Once you have reviewed and confirmed all the details, sign and date the form as required.
10
Keep a copy of the completed claim form for your records before submitting it to the appropriate party.
Who needs a patient claim form?
A patient claim form is usually needed by individuals who have received medical services and want to file a claim with their insurance company. This form allows the patient to request reimbursement for the expenses incurred during their medical treatment. It is essential for patients who have health insurance coverage and wish to receive financial assistance for their medical costs. Additionally, healthcare providers or facilities may also require patients to fill out a claim form to process insurance claims on their behalf.
